State tax filing
Form PA-1000 "Property Tax or Rent Rebate Claim" is included within the TurboTax software when a Pennsylvania state return is started.
Form PA-1000 is a "stand alone" form, meaning it is not part of the Pennsylvania state return.
When the Pennsylvania return was generated in your TurboTax program, Form PA-1000 was also added.
When it was established that the Pennsylvania return (PA-40) was not needed, Form PA was automatically removed.
Form PA-1000 was not deleted as was Form PA-40 since the credit can still be applied for by some taxpayers, even when a tax return is not needed to be filed for them. You are not one of those taxpayers.
Since PA-1000 is showing all zeroes, once you are ready to file, the PA-1000 would be disregarded, and you would not be instructed to mail it in.
However, to clean up your TurboTax account, since PA-1000 is not needed, you can delete Form PA-1000.
Using TurboTax Desktop, switch to Form Mode (top right), find the form and select delete at the bottom of the screen
